    Default Bridgestone Supercat tyres

    Anyone run these? I'm currently looking for a set of 235/45/17 and bridgestone have these for $159. what are they like?

    Can anyone else recommend anything better around the same price?

    Bobjane suck, as I'm still waiting for a response from about 3 weeks ago, so they are out of the equation!

    Edit: what is the Bridgestone designation for these? ie RE92, ER300... because I cannot find any info on them on their website!!

    they don't really have a model desination ( i.e. re92 etc ), they are made by Bridgestone under the Supercat name ( Supercat dont have indvidual models, once a new design is relased they just use that for all their sizes ), for what you pay, they are fantastic, i recommend them all the time and i work for a BTC btw.
